Client Overview
The client is a USA-based company operating on full-fledge to develop IT services and solutions using their strong work ethics. The company had the privilege of working in different industries, making them the best in the business. The company’s services include website development, DevOps, CMS design, Branding/Logo, and UI/UX design.
Challenge Countered
After the period of stagnancy, the company started expanding, due to which they had to make use of existing standard code and licensed applications. Not to forget the scaling functionalities that were the need of the hour to meet the rigorous demands of globally distributed teams and their future expectations. This is where the company was in desperate need of quality assurance software that could turn its negative ROI as a result of high licensing and maintenance costs into a big positive.
Solutions
After examining the client’s exact requirements, we concluded that a test automation framework consisting of an all-inclusive dashboard, lethal analytics, and custom features aligned with Client’s business model was Needed. Using this approach, we developed robust yet reliable, unparalleled usability and convenience to ensure the company had total control over the test procedures.
- We performed a feasibility study and selected test cases to define the automation strategy properly.
- Next, we designed a framework by testing data and redefining the abstraction layer.
- Then, we curated test scripts and functional libraries to manage repositories.
- We replicated the test environment by deploying test suites, which helped us decipher tracking and closure.
- The process did not stop there. We performed defect testing to maintain the test suite.
- This resulted in a complete overhaul of the testing strategy of the company. They replaced the time-consuming and expensive manual processes with our automated regression testing.
- Our QA team scrutinized the company’s IT hub and delved deep into its organizational hierarchy and infrastructure. This revealed that the existing QA process used Drupal and Web Builder components.
- We evaluated the existing test cases and derived a checklist for reuse. This way, a global and custom-built test case was developed.
Benefits
- We revolutionized the resting process at Client, which enabled the company to develop more than 50 apps and achieve the desired level of precision in testing efficiency.
- More than 200 automation test cases were implemented by following an all-inclusive quality assurance process, which reduced the scope of defects appearing in the production process.
- We provided graphs and charts with a 360-degree overview of the company’s testing results.
- We performed mobile web testing to make sure that the app works consistently across different devices and platforms.
- Using our defect categorization and classification feature, we swiftly determined and resolved the issues in the development process.
- With the help of our proprietary license optimization, the company increased its ROI by 50%, resulting in a shortened feedback cycle, thereby providing a definite edge to the production process at Client’s company.